Output 699219dc30f133ec96336be1657baf24414eecdd0b5227569ca78c3a2c8fe70a:14
- value
- 42446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8921fa5953005d3d495c50e66a90d1d5f7fd958b OP_EQUAL
- address
- 3EC7CenABa7JCCwSBSoRvStaVybXBPKZQm
- transaction
- 699219dc30f133ec96336be1657baf24414eecdd0b5227569ca78c3a2c8fe70a